我能够实现拖放从一个ListView控件拖放到其他的ListView与此博文的帮助
Windows 8的拖放
我也能reoder在相同的ListView项目
CanReorderItems="True"
但我不能够在需要的位置从一个ListView控件放置项目的其他ListView控件。
有没有办法找出发生了下降,这样我可以在使用插入方法位置插入的位置。
我能够实现拖放从一个ListView控件拖放到其他的ListView与此博文的帮助
Windows 8的拖放
我也能reoder在相同的ListView项目
CanReorderItems="True"
但我不能够在需要的位置从一个ListView控件放置项目的其他ListView控件。
有没有办法找出发生了下降,这样我可以在使用插入方法位置插入的位置。
http://www.codeproject.com/Articles/536519/Extending-GridView-with-Drag-and-Drop-for-Grouping
该GridViewEx控件实现拖放对于没有通过正规GridView控件支持的情况:
- 对于除WrapGrid,StackPanel中,和VirtualizingStackPanel其他项目的面板。
- 当分组已启用。
它也允许添加新组基础数据源,如果用户拖动一些项目到最左或最右的控制的边缘。
谢谢@Xyroid! 这正是我一直在寻找
这应该可以帮助:
XAML ListView和GridView的重新排序和拖放样品(Windows 8.1中) http://code.msdn.microsoft.com/windowsapps/XAML-ListView-and-GridView-6bd77f71